Solution for -7-b=6(6b+5) equation:


Simplifying
-7 + -1b = 6(6b + 5)

Reorder the terms:
-7 + -1b = 6(5 + 6b)
-7 + -1b = (5 * 6 + 6b * 6)
-7 + -1b = (30 + 36b)

Solving
-7 + -1b = 30 + 36b

Solving for variable 'b'.

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-36b' to each side of the equation.
-7 + -1b + -36b = 30 + 36b + -36b

Combine like terms: -1b + -36b = -37b
-7 + -37b = 30 + 36b + -36b

Combine like terms: 36b + -36b = 0
-7 + -37b = 30 + 0
-7 + -37b = 30

Add '7' to each side of the equation.
-7 + 7 + -37b = 30 + 7

Combine like terms: -7 + 7 = 0
0 + -37b = 30 + 7
-37b = 30 + 7

Combine like terms: 30 + 7 = 37
-37b = 37

Divide each side by '-37'.
b = -1

Simplifying
b = -1
